539,876 is a composite number, even.
539,876 (five hundred thirty-nine thousand eight hundred seventy-six)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2² × 139 × 971. Written other ways, in hexadecimal, 0x83CE4.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 539876, here are decompositions:
- 13 + 539863 = 539876
- 37 + 539839 = 539876
- 79 + 539797 = 539876
- 163 + 539713 = 539876
- 199 + 539677 = 539876
- 223 + 539653 = 539876
- 367 + 539509 = 539876
- 373 + 539503 = 539876
Showing the first eight; more decompositions exist.
